Synopsis

A fresh look at how modern scholarship shapes our view of Jesus and the early Christianity. This edition surveys recent literature on gospel origins, Luke’s authorship, and the critical debates that have reshaped our understanding of the life of Christ. It connects philology, history, and theology to show how scholars test sources and reframe well-known texts.


Readers will follow discussions of famous critics, learn how different from previous views these debates are, and see how literary and historical analysis influence the way we read the Gospels today. The volume treats complex ideas with careful nuance, making scholarly argument accessible while keeping the original material in view.
